FAQs
What is sports medicine?
A branch of medicine dealing with treatment and prevention of sports- and exercise-related injuries and improving fitness and performance.
What conditions do sports medicine specialists treat?
Acute traumas (fractures, sprains, strains, dislocations), chronic overuse injuries (tendonitis, degenerative diseases, overtraining), and other sports/exercise-related injuries.
